O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
defs:regExp
(Results
1 - 9
of
9
) sorted by null
/external/webkit/Source/JavaScriptCore/runtime/
RegExpCache.cpp
34
PassRefPtr<
RegExp
> RegExpCache::lookupOrCreate(const UString& patternString, RegExpFlags flags)
46
PassRefPtr<
RegExp
> RegExpCache::create(const UString& patternString, RegExpFlags flags, RegExpCacheMap::iterator iterator)
48
RefPtr<
RegExp
>
regExp
=
RegExp
::create(m_globalData, patternString, flags);
51
return
regExp
;
55
iterator->second =
regExp
;
67
return
regExp
;
RegExpObject.h
25
#include "
RegExp
.h"
33
RegExpObject(JSGlobalObject*, Structure*, NonNullPassRefPtr<
RegExp
>);
36
void setRegExp(PassRefPtr<
RegExp
> r) { d->
regExp
= r; }
37
RegExp
*
regExp
() const { return d->
regExp
.get(); }
77
RegExpObjectData(NonNullPassRefPtr<
RegExp
>
regExp
)
78
:
regExp
(regExp
[
all
...]
RegExpConstructor.cpp
36
#include "
RegExp
.h"
99
: InternalFunction(&exec->globalData(), globalObject, structure, Identifier(exec, "
RegExp
"))
104
// ECMA 15.10.5.1
RegExp
.prototype
303
return throwError(exec, createTypeError(exec, "Cannot supply flags when constructing one
RegExp
from another."));
317
return throwError(exec, createSyntaxError(exec, "Invalid flags supplied to
RegExp
constructor."));
320
RefPtr<
RegExp
>
regExp
= exec->globalData().regExpCache()->lookupOrCreate(pattern, flags);
321
if (!
regExp
->isValid())
322
return throwError(exec, createSyntaxError(exec,
regExp
->errorMessage()));
323
return new (exec) RegExpObject(exec->lexicalGlobalObject(), globalObject->regExpStructure(),
regExp
.release())
[
all
...]
/external/webkit/Source/JavaScriptCore/jit/
JITStubs.h
60
class
RegExp
;
73
RegExp
*
regExp
() { return static_cast<
RegExp
*>(asPointer); }
JITStubs.cpp
[
all
...]
/external/webkit/Source/WebCore/bindings/js/
SerializedScriptValue.cpp
48
#include <runtime/
RegExp
.h>
160
*
RegExp
:-
462
RegExpObject*
regExp
= asRegExpObject(obj);
465
if (
regExp
->
regExp
()->global())
467
if (
regExp
->
regExp
()->ignoreCase())
469
if (
regExp
->
regExp
()->multiline())
472
write(
regExp
->regExp()->pattern())
[
all
...]
/external/webkit/Source/WebCore/bindings/v8/
SerializedScriptValue.cpp
223
void writeRegExp(v8::Local<v8::String> pattern, v8::
RegExp
::Flags flags)
662
v8::Handle<v8::
RegExp
>
regExp
= value.As<v8::
RegExp
>();
663
m_writer.writeRegExp(
regExp
->GetSource(),
regExp
->GetFlags());
943
*value = v8::
RegExp
::New(pattern.As<v8::String>(), static_cast<v8::
RegExp
::Flags>(flags));
[
all
...]
/external/webkit/Source/WebCore/bridge/qt/
qt_runtime.cpp
101
RegExp
,
114
"
RegExp
", "Array", "RTObject", "Object", "Null", "RTArray"};
174
return
RegExp
;
226
case
RegExp
:
571
if (type ==
RegExp
) {
593
qConvDebug() << "couldn't parse a JS
regexp
";
851
RefPtr<JSC::
RegExp
>
regExp
= JSC::
RegExp
::create(&exec->globalData(), pattern, flags);
852
if (
regExp
->isValid()
[
all
...]
/prebuilt/common/ant/
ant.jar
Completed in 183 milliseconds